EU proposes Munich as venue for Mideast Quartet meeting

Berlin, Jan 8, IRNA -- The European Union said Munich could be the venue for a meeting of the Mideast Quartet comprised of the EU, UN, Russia and the US, the German Press Agency dpa reported from Brussels on Friday.
The Mideast Quartet could meet on the sidelines of the Munich Security Conference, scheduled to be held in the southern German city from February 4 through 6, a spokeswoman for EU foreign policy chief Catherine Ashton was quoted saying.
'We believe this would be a good opportunity,' she added.
This would mean that the US Secretary of State Hillary Clinton and her Russian counterpart Sergei Lavrov would have to travel to Munich for such a meeting of the Quartet.
Lavrov is also slated to attend the Munich security meeting.
The talks are aimed at last-ditch efforts to jump-start Mideast peace talks which have stalled over the highly controversial settlement policies of the Zionist regime./end
